Commit 79101ecc authored by Poul-Henning Kamp's avatar Poul-Henning Kamp Committed by Dridi Boukelmoune

Move the wrk+pool summed stats into group 'wrk'.

This eliminates read-add-zero-write on counters outside this group.

.. varnish_vsc:: sess_fail_econnaborted
:group: wrk
:oneliner: Session accept failures: connection aborted
Detailed reason for sess_fail: Connection aborted by the
client, usually harmless.
.. varnish_vsc:: sess_fail_eintr
:group: wrk
:oneliner: Session accept failures: interrupted system call
Detailed reason for sess_fail: The accept() call was
interrupted, usually harmless
.. varnish_vsc:: sess_fail_emfile
:group: wrk
:oneliner: Session accept failures: too many open files
Detailed reason for sess_fail: No file descriptor was
available. Consider raising RLIMIT_NOFILE (see ulimit -n).
.. varnish_vsc:: sess_fail_ebadf
:group: wrk
:oneliner: Session accept failures: bad file descriptor
Detailed reason for sess_fail: The listen socket file
descriptor was invalid. Should never happen.
.. varnish_vsc:: sess_fail_enomem
:group: wrk
:oneliner: Session accept failures: not enough memory
Detailed reason for sess_fail: Most likely insufficient
socket buffer memory. Should never happen
.. varnish_vsc:: sess_fail_other
:group: wrk
:oneliner: Session accept failures: other
Detailed reason for sess_fail: neither of the above, see
Debug log (varnishlog -g raw -I Debug:^Accept).
